![]() ![]() When creating a pull request, you should care about the title and the description. If the code does more than one thing, break it into other pull requests. Just like classes and modules, pull requests should do only one thing.įollowing the SRP reduces the overhead caused by revising a code that attempts to solve several problems.īefore submitting a PR for review, try applying the single responsibility principle. The single responsibility principle (SRP) is a computer programming principle that states that every module or class should have responsibility for a single part of the functionality provided by the software, and that responsibility should be entirely encapsulated by the class.
